Linux pyaudio的安全性分析

小樊
81
2024-10-01 06:52:07

Python Audio Library (PyAudio) 是一個(gè)用于處理音頻的 Python 庫(kù),它允許開(kāi)發(fā)者創(chuàng)建和操作音頻流。關(guān)于其安全性,我們可以從幾個(gè)方面進(jìn)行分析:

  1. 代碼質(zhì)量和審計(jì):PyAudio 的源代碼是公開(kāi)的,任何人都可以查看和審計(jì)。這有助于發(fā)現(xiàn)潛在的安全漏洞。然而,由于代碼量可能很大,審計(jì)工作可能需要一定的時(shí)間和專業(yè)知識(shí)。
  2. 依賴關(guān)系:PyAudio 依賴于一些其他的 Python 庫(kù)和系統(tǒng)級(jí)的組件。如果這些依賴項(xiàng)存在安全漏洞,那么 PyAudio 也可能受到影響。因此,定期檢查和更新這些依賴項(xiàng)是很重要的。
  3. 使用場(chǎng)景:PyAudio 主要用于處理音頻流,這可能涉及到用戶的敏感信息,如音頻數(shù)據(jù)。因此,在使用 PyAudio 時(shí),開(kāi)發(fā)者需要確保采取適當(dāng)?shù)陌踩胧缂用軅鬏數(shù)囊纛l數(shù)據(jù),以防止數(shù)據(jù)泄露或被惡意利用。
  4. 社區(qū)和更新:一個(gè)活躍的開(kāi)發(fā)者社區(qū)可以及時(shí)發(fā)現(xiàn)并修復(fù)安全漏洞。PyAudio 有一個(gè)相對(duì)活躍的社區(qū),定期發(fā)布更新和改進(jìn)。這意味著發(fā)現(xiàn)并修復(fù)安全問(wèn)題的可能性相對(duì)較高。
  5. 安全漏洞報(bào)告:如果 PyAudio 存在已知的安全漏洞,這些信息通常會(huì)通過(guò)官方渠道(如 GitHub 倉(cāng)庫(kù)、安全公告等)進(jìn)行公布。開(kāi)發(fā)者應(yīng)該定期檢查這些信息,并及時(shí)采取相應(yīng)的措施來(lái)保護(hù)自己的系統(tǒng)。

總的來(lái)說(shuō),雖然 PyAudio 可能存在一些安全風(fēng)險(xiǎn),但通過(guò)采取適當(dāng)?shù)陌踩胧┖捅3峙c社區(qū)的緊密聯(lián)系,可以有效地降低這些風(fēng)險(xiǎn)。在評(píng)估 PyAudio 的安全性時(shí),建議綜合考慮上述因素。

0